Understanding Allergic Reactions and Skin Response
Allergic reactions can manifest in many ways, but skin irritation is one of the most common symptoms. When allergens come in contact with the skin, they trigger an immune response that leads to redness, swelling, itching, and sometimes hives. This inflammatory process causes discomfort and can disrupt daily life.
Skin affected by allergies is sensitive and requires gentle care. Choosing the right shower temperature can influence how your skin reacts during an allergic episode. Both hot and cold water have distinct effects on blood vessels, nerve endings, and inflammatory responses. Understanding these effects is key to managing symptoms effectively.
The Science Behind Hot Water on Allergic Skin
Hot water opens up blood vessels through vasodilation, which increases blood flow to the surface of the skin. This can provide a temporary feeling of relaxation and loosen clogged pores. However, hot water also strips away natural oils from the skin’s surface, potentially worsening dryness and irritation.
For someone experiencing an allergic reaction, hot showers might intensify itching by increasing nerve sensitivity. The heat can exacerbate inflammation, making redness and swelling more prominent. Additionally, hot water may weaken the skin barrier function over time, leading to increased susceptibility to allergens.
While some people find relief from muscle tension with warm water, it’s generally not recommended for acute allergic flare-ups due to its pro-inflammatory effects on sensitive skin.
How Cold Water Benefits Allergic Reaction Symptoms
Cold water has a constricting effect on blood vessels known as vasoconstriction. This reduces blood flow to the inflamed area, which helps decrease swelling and redness associated with allergic reactions. The cooling sensation also numbs nerve endings temporarily, providing relief from intense itching or burning sensations.
Applying cold water slows down the release of histamines—the chemicals responsible for allergy symptoms—helping calm irritated skin faster than hot water might. Cold showers also help maintain moisture levels by preserving natural oils better than hot water does.
That said, extremely cold showers might be uncomfortable or cause skin tightening that some people find unpleasant during allergies. Lukewarm or cool showers are often a better compromise for soothing symptoms without shocking the body.

The Role of Shower Duration and Frequency in Allergy Management
The temperature isn’t the only factor affecting allergic reactions during showers—the length and frequency matter too. Long showers tend to dry out the skin regardless of temperature because they wash away protective oils that shield against irritants.
Shorter showers lasting about 5-10 minutes minimize moisture loss while still cleansing effectively. Frequent bathing with hot or cold water can disrupt the skin barrier over time, so it’s important to balance hygiene needs with symptom control.
For allergy-prone individuals, showering once daily with lukewarm to cool water is often sufficient unless excessive sweating or dirt accumulation occurs. After showering, gently patting the skin dry instead of rubbing helps prevent further irritation.
The Best Shower Practices During an Allergic Reaction
To maximize relief while minimizing harm when dealing with allergic rashes or hives:
- Opt for cool or lukewarm water: This reduces inflammation without shocking your system.
- Avoid harsh soaps: Use fragrance-free, hypoallergenic cleansers that won’t aggravate your skin.
- Limit shower time: Keep it brief to prevent drying out your skin.
- Moisturize immediately: Apply a gentle moisturizer right after patting dry to lock in hydration.
- Avoid scrubbing: Use soft cloths or your hands gently—no rough exfoliation during flare-ups.
- Avoid sudden temperature changes: Rapid shifts from hot to cold can stress sensitive skin further.
Following these steps ensures your shower routine supports healing rather than worsening symptoms.
The Impact of Shower Temperature on Immune Response in Allergies
Allergic reactions are driven by immune system overactivity where mast cells release histamine and other chemicals causing inflammation. Temperature plays a role in modulating this immune response locally at the skin level.
Cold exposure inhibits mast cell degranulation (release of histamine), thereby reducing itchiness and swelling quickly. Conversely, heat encourages mast cells to release more histamine which can prolong or intensify allergic symptoms.
Thus, cold showers act as a natural anti-inflammatory treatment during allergy episodes by dampening immune overreaction right where it hurts most—the affected skin area.

Dermatologist Recommendations on Hot Or Cold Shower For Allergic Reaction
Skin specialists often advise patients with eczema-like allergies or contact dermatitis episodes to avoid hot showers altogether because they aggravate dryness and itching severely.
They recommend:
- Lukewarm or cool baths/showers as first-line care during flare-ups.
- Mild cleansers free from dyes and fragrances that could trigger reactions.
- Avoidance of prolonged exposure to any extreme temperatures which compromise barrier function.
- Consistent use of emollients immediately after bathing for optimal recovery.
These guidelines support choosing cooler shower temperatures as safer options when dealing with allergic reactions affecting the skin’s surface.
Cautionary Notes: When Not To Rely Solely On Hot Or Cold Showers For Allergies
Although shower temperature adjustments help alleviate mild-to-moderate allergic reactions externally:
- If you experience severe swelling (angioedema), difficulty breathing, or widespread hives seek emergency medical attention immediately rather than relying on home remedies alone.
- Persistent rashes unresponsive to topical care require professional diagnosis as underlying conditions like eczema or psoriasis might mimic allergy symptoms but need different treatments.
- Avoid using extremely cold water if you have circulatory problems such as Raynaud’s phenomenon since it could worsen symptoms unrelated to allergies but triggered by cold exposure.
Prioritizing safety alongside symptom management ensures proper outcomes beyond just adjusting shower routines.
